Introduction à l électronique. Numérique. Licence Physique et Applications. Électronique séquentiel

Documents pareils
FONCTION COMPTAGE BINAIRE ET DIVISION DE FRÉQUENCE

VIII- Circuits séquentiels. Mémoires

Architecture des ordinateurs TD1 - Portes logiques et premiers circuits

Logique séquentielle

IFT1215 Introduction aux systèmes informatiques

TD Architecture des ordinateurs. Jean-Luc Dekeyser

ELP 304 : Électronique Numérique. Cours 1 Introduction

QUESTION 1 {2 points}

Université de La Rochelle. Réseaux TD n 6

Système binaire. Algèbre booléenne

Les fonctions logiques

Comprendre «le travail collaboratif»

GPA770 Microélectronique appliquée Exercices série A

Logique binaire. Aujourd'hui, l'algèbre de Boole trouve de nombreuses applications en informatique et dans la conception des circuits électroniques.

RESUME DE COURS ET CAHIER D'EXERCICES

Recueil d'exercices de logique séquentielle

Chapitre 4 : Les mémoires

ET 24 : Modèle de comportement d un système Boucles de programmation avec Labview.

INTRODUCTION AUX SYSTEMES D EXPLOITATION. TD2 Exclusion mutuelle / Sémaphores

- Instrumentation numérique -

Fonctions de la couche physique

Cours de Programmation en Langage Synchrone SIGNAL. Bernard HOUSSAIS IRISA. Équipe ESPRESSO

Architecture des ordinateurs

Exécutif temps réel Pierre-Yves Duval (cppm)

Hélène Lœvenbruck, Christophe Savariaux, Dorothée Lefebvre

CONVERTISSEURS NA ET AN

L exclusion mutuelle distribuée

EPREUVE OPTIONNELLE d INFORMATIQUE CORRIGE

Le Collège de France crée une chaire pérenne d Informatique, Algorithmes, machines et langages, et nomme le Pr Gérard BERRY titulaire

MICROCONTROLEURS PIC PROGRAMMATION EN C. V. Chollet - cours-pic-13b - 09/12/2012 Page 1 sur 44

La conversion de données : Convertisseur Analogique Numérique (CAN) Convertisseur Numérique Analogique (CNA)

Les portes logiques. Voici les symboles des trois fonctions de base. Portes AND. Portes OR. Porte NOT

SYSTEME DE PALPAGE A TRANSMISSION RADIO ETUDE DU RECEPTEUR (MI16) DOSSIER DE PRESENTATION. Contenu du dossier :

UE 503 L3 MIAGE. Initiation Réseau et Programmation Web La couche physique. A. Belaïd

J AUVRAY Systèmes Electroniques TRANSMISSION DES SIGNAUX NUMERIQUES : SIGNAUX EN BANDE DE BASE

Transmissions série et parallèle

Télécommunications. Plan

Eléments de spécification des systèmes temps réel Pierre-Yves Duval (cppm)

Conception de circuits numériques et architecture des ordinateurs

Manipulations du laboratoire

FICHE UE Licence/Master Sciences, Technologies, Santé Mention Informatique

Modules d automatismes simples

TEPZZ A_T EP A1 (19) (11) EP A1 (12) DEMANDE DE BREVET EUROPEEN. (51) Int Cl.: G07F 7/08 ( ) G06K 19/077 (2006.

Introduction à l informatique temps réel Pierre-Yves Duval (cppm)

TP Modulation Démodulation BPSK

ISC Système d Information Architecture et Administration d un SGBD Compléments SQL


COMMANDER la puissance par MODULATION COMMUNIQUER

I- Définitions des signaux.

TD 1 - Transmission en bande de passe

I. TRANSMISSION DE DONNEES

Algèbre binaire et Circuits logiques ( )

Guide de programmation FLEXIVOZ PABX OD308

Parallélisme et Répartition

La couche réseau Le protocole X.25

Transmission de données. A) Principaux éléments intervenant dans la transmission

Concevoir son microprocesseur

Les techniques de multiplexage

Définir les différents paramètres pour le mode hôtel. Les différents attributs que l on désire associer aux chambres.

Auto formation à Zelio logic

Conception des systèmes répartis

TD 11. Les trois montages fondamentaux E.C, B.C, C.C ; comparaisons et propriétés. Association d étages. *** :exercice traité en classe.

1 Mesure de la performance d un système temps réel : la gigue

SCIENCES POUR L INGENIEUR

SUR MODULE CAMÉRA C38A (OV7620)

Spécifications Techniques d Interface

Veille Technologique : la VoIP

Description d'une liaison

Recherche dans un tableau

Projet Active Object

Programmation C++ (débutant)/instructions for, while et do...while

Architecture des ordinateurs. Robin FERCOQ

AMBUS IS Collecteur d impulsions M-Bus

Le Millenium 3 pour les nuls!! Phase 2 : Les blocs fonction

Organigramme / Algorigramme Dossier élève 1 SI

Réplication des données

Architecture matérielle des systèmes informatiques

Master d'informatique 1ère année Réseaux et protocoles. Couche physique

IV- Comment fonctionne un ordinateur?

WinTask x64 Le Planificateur de tâches sous Windows 7 64 bits, Windows 8/ bits, Windows 2008 R2 et Windows bits

Patentamt JEuropaisches. European Patent Office Numéro de publication: Office européen des brevets DEMANDE DE BREVET EUROPEEN

Comme chaque ligne de cache a 1024 bits. Le nombre de lignes de cache contenu dans chaque ensemble est:

Organisation des Ordinateurs

1. PRESENTATION DU PROJET

MANUEL D UTILISATION Version R1013

UE Programmation Impérative Licence 2ème Année

Info0101 Intro. à l'algorithmique et à la programmation. Cours 3. Le langage Java

La norme Midi et JavaSound

Cisco Discovery - DRSEnt Module 7

Cours de Systèmes d Exploitation

UML : DIAGRAMME D ETATS

Atelier C TIA Portal CTIA04 : Programmation des automates S7-300 Opérations numériques

Expérience 3 Formats de signalisation binaire

Chapitre I La fonction transmission

Initiation au HPC - Généralités

ITIL Gestion de la continuité des services informatiques

Architectures haute disponibilité avec MySQL. Olivier Olivier DASINI DASINI - -

Multicast & IGMP Snooping

Transcription:

Introduction à l électronique Numérique Licence Physique et Applications Électronique séquentiel Fabrice CAIGNET LAA - CN fcaignet@laas.fr http://www.laas.fr/~fcaignet

Plan du Cours I. Introduction II. Les bascules A. Bascules B. Bascules JK C. Bascules D III. Les compteurs A. Asynchrones B. ynchrones

I. I. Introduction notion de de système séquentiel Définition Le système combinatoire est un système dont l état des sorties ne dépend que de l état des entrées L évolution des sorties est définie par une fonction booléenne des variables d entrée, La notion temporelle ne fait pas partie de cette représentation. ue ue se se passerait-t-il si si on on prenait prenait en en compte l aspect temporel, et et si si on on rebouclait un un système sur sur lui-même???

I. I. Introduction notion de de système séquentiel Définition n E E Variables d entrée E r Variables de sortie r Le Le système système séquentiel séquentiel est est un un système système dont dont l état l état des des sorties sorties dépend dépend :: --De De l état l état des des entrées entrées --De De l état l état des des sorties sortiesà l instant l instant précédent précédent n y Y y y Y y (t+) = f(e,(t)) y m Y y m m L aspect L aspect temps temps de de réponse réponse du du système système est est primordial primordial Variables internes

I. I. Introduction notion de de système séquentiel Définition Exemple de l importance temporelle: A B C Déterminer la fréquence d oscillation A B C Ici Ici c est c est le le temps temps de de réponse réponse de de l inverseur l inverseur qui qui est est primordial primordial

I. I. Introduction notion de de système séquentiel Définition Exemple simple : Donner l équation du système On donne le schéma électrique A Donner la table de vérité B (t) Importance Importance de de définir définir (t) (t) à l instant l instant ttet et à l instant l instant t+ t+

II. II. Les Les bascules La La bascule On considère le schéma électrique suivant upposition!! O t t+ O

II. II. Les Les bascules La La bascule t t t+ t État mémoire t Interdit Mise à Mise à État interdit t+= t+= Équation Équation ::

II. II. Les Les bascules La La bascule Autre forme de la bascule : () () Ici la table de vérité reste la même, mais on utilise des NANDs

II. II. Les Les bascules La La bascule Application : circuit anti-rebond +5V kω kω

II. II. Les Les bascules La La bascule Même bascule que précédemment, mais active sur le niveau haut d une horloge () t t () t t En électronique numérique, on appelle horloge un dispositif délivrant un signal périodique carré dont l'amplitude évolue entre V et +VAl représentant respectivement le et le logiques

II. II. Les Les bascules La La bascule et et ses ses déclinaisons Bascule Active sur niveau Bascule Active sur front montant Bascule Active sur front descendant t+ t+ t+ X X t - X X t - X X t t t t Inter Inter Inter

II. II. Les Les bascules La La bascule JK JK On désire à partir d un bascule réaliser une bascule dont le tableau de vérité est donné : J K t+ t O t t+= t+= Équation Équation ::

J K J K J K J K 3 3 3 3 3 La bascule JK La bascule JK Application : réalisation d un diviseur de fréquence par n t t t t 3 II. Les bascules II. Les bascules

II. II. Les Les bascules La La bascule D D D D t+ t+= t+= Équation Équation :: X t a fonction principale est de synchroniser les données (les transférer uniquement sur la commande de )

II. II. Les Les bascules Généralités sur sur les les bascules :: fonctionnement synchrone et et asynchrone Entrées ortie Preset Clear J K n+ emarques AYNC x x x x x x x x x * Mise à Mise à état imprévisible YNC n n état stable mise à mise à commutation les entrées asynchrones agissent au niveau bas; il faut les porter au logique pour qu elles agissent Preset Clear

III. III. Les Les compteurs Les compteurs se présentent généralement sous la forme de circuits intégrés. Ces derniers contiennent principalement des bascules. Ils comptent, suivant le système de numération binaire, le nombre d impulsions appliquées à leur entrée. uivant qu une nouvelle impulsion incrémente ou décrémente la valeur du mot binaire de sortie, le circuit fonctionne respectivement en compteur ou en décompteur.

III. III. Les Les compteurs Compteur 3 bits bits Entrée de mise à AZ poids fort orloge COMPTEU orties poids faible Il Il existe existe deux deux types types de de compteurs :: --les les compteurs Asynchrones --les les compteurs ynchrones

J K J K J K AZ III. Les compteurs III. Les compteurs chéma d un compteur 3 bits Asynchrone chéma d un compteur 3 bits Asynchrone chéma réalisé avec des bascules JK

III. III. Les Les compteurs Chronogrammes d un d un compteur 3 bits bits --Asynchrone :: orloge active sur front descendant 3 4 5 6 7

III. III. Les Les compteurs ésumé d un d un compteur 3 bits bits --Asynchrone :: Le compteur précédent compte de à 7. On dit que c est un compteur modulo 8. En observant les signaux on remarque que : F = F/ F = F/4 F = F/8 F : fréquence du signal F : fréquence du signal F : fréquence du signal F : fréquence du signal Un Un compteur peut servir de de diviseur de de fréquences.

III. III. Les Les compteurs Compteur 3 bits bits --ynchrone :: Dans Dans la la structure asynchrone, l impulsion de de progression du du compteur est est appliquée sur sur l entrée d horloge du du premier étage, étage, les les entrées d horloge des des autres autres bascules reçoivent le le signal signal de de sortie sortie de de l étage l étage précédent. Dans Dans la la structure synchrone, l horloge est est la la même même pour pour tous tous les les étages. Le Le basculement de de toutes toutes les les sorties sorties se se fait fait en enmême temps. temps. Mise en en œuvre d un compteur synchrone 3 bits

III. III. Les Les compteurs Exemple d un d un compteur ynchrone :: le le 74XX93